How much do stadium cleaning j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for stadium cleaning in the United States is $16.84,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$18.51 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Stadium Cleaning position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Stadium Cleaning professional, you should have attention to detail, physical stamina, and reliability, typically with a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with industrial cleaning equipment, chemical cleaning agents, and safety protocols is often required, with some employers providing on-the-job training or requiring OSHA safety certification. Strong teamwork, time management skills, and a positive attitude help individuals excel in this fast-paced, collaborative environment. These qualities are crucial for efficiently maintaining cleanliness and safety standards in large venues, especially during events with tight turnaround times.

What is a Stadium Cleaning job?

A Stadium Cleaning job involves maintaining the cleanliness of a sports or event venue before, during, and after events. Responsibilities include sweeping, mopping, trash removal, disinfecting seating areas, and cleaning restrooms. Workers may also be responsible for handling spills and assisting with waste disposal and recycling efforts. This job requires attention to detail, efficiency,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ment.

What does a typical work schedule look like for a stadium cleaning position?

Stadium cleaning roles often have variable schedules that can include early mornings, late nights, weekends, and holidays, especially around events such as games or concerts. Shifts are typically structured to ensure the stadium is ready for public use before and after events, so flexibility is important. You can expect to work both as part of a team during major clean-up operations and individually on specific assignments. The work is usually fast-paced and deadline-driven, but it offers opportunities for overtime and advancement to supervisory positions for those who demonstrate strong performance and commitment.

About 4M:
Founded in 1978, 4M Building Solutions is a janitorial, housekeeping, cleaning, and disinfecting services company headquartered in St. Louis, MO. Supported by 8,000 associates, the company operates in 30+ states across the Midwest, Northeast, and Southeastern United States.
